Installing a KX-TDA3192 Simplified Voice Message (SVM) card into a Panasonic KX-TDA15 or KX-TDA30
Hybrid IP PBX provides extension users with a simplified voicemail solution. Companies looking to
provide a cost-effective voicemail solution to enhance customer service and provide employees with a
private voicemail can benefit greatly from this solution.

Each extension user can have a personal Voice Mailbox which can both play outgoing greeting messages
as well as record incoming voice messages irrespective of the type of extension used, e.g. Proprietary
Telephones (PT), Single Line Telephones (SLT), or Portable Stations (PS). The recording storage space on
each voicemail box is shared between outgoing greeting messages and received voicemail messages.
Extension users can record, listen to or clear their own greeting messages - as well as playback and clear
voice messages left by outside callers.

Each SVM card supports two (2) channels, allowing two users to access the card simultaneously. The
system supports up to two SVM cards per PBX for added recording storage capacity. Accessing the
voicemail requires dialling each SVM card extension number.

To allow callers to be able to leave voicemail
messages - extension users can set their phone to
be redirected to the SVM card's extension number -
when in busy or in no-answer state. When the SVM
card answers a redirected call, it plays back the
relevant extension user greetings to the caller and
gives option to record a voice message.

Each mailbox is protected by an individually
assigned PIN number.

Type of Mailbox
Personal Mailbox
The SVM message card can be configured to
provide individual extension users their own
Private mailbox.

Group Mailbox (Company Mailbox)
Extension users - e.g. Sales agents or support staff
- that are members of a Calling Group, can
configure a Group Mailbox to record all incoming
messages. Any member of the group can then
retrieve the recorded messages.

Direct Mailbox Recording
The SVM card allows a caller to leave a voice
message directly in the mailbox of another
extension. It is also possible to transfer a caller
directly to the mailbox of another extension. In
this case, the target extension doesn't ring. This
feature would greatly benefit a Boss/Secretary
work environment.

Message Recording Time
SVM can handle up to 125 individual messages
(greetings and voice messages) with a maximum
total recording time of 120 minutes (60 minutes
default) per card. The total capacity of the SVM card
is shared between all extension users with a
voicemail box.

Voice messages can be limited
(default 120 seconds).
Recording time/quality can be selected as shown in
the System Capacity Table.
